Output 321c59ab0bd85ae382d498cc53084e3e06e42d92298e881b6b42bb71bf7265a3:75

value
14731600
script pubkey
OP_0 OP_PUSHBYTES_20 59cd0d229f91602fbcb902f3f808cbfd12df0a25
address
ltc1qt8xs6g5lj9szl09eqtelszxtl5fd7z399c4x42
transaction
321c59ab0bd85ae382d498cc53084e3e06e42d92298e881b6b42bb71bf7265a3
spent
true